I saw that same demo at the Tri-County fair last year. The key thing is that gas is great for fast, clean heats like scrollwork. But coal still wins for certain jobs, like when you need to heat a big piece in one spot. My old teacher always said gas is a precision tool, but coal lets you really work the metal. It's not that one is real and the other isn't. You just pick the right tool for the job. I still fire up the coal forge for any serious drawing out.
